Merge LCIO files.
More...
|
| __init__ (self, **kwargs) |
|
| cmd_args (self) |
| Setup command arguments.
|
|
| config (self, parser) |
| Configure LCIOTool component.
|
|
| required_config (self) |
| Return list of required config.
|
|
| required_parameters (self) |
| Return list of required parameters.
|
|
| cmd_line_str (self) |
|
| execute (self, log_out=sys.stdout, log_err=sys.stderr) |
| Generic component execution method.
|
|
| cmd_exists (self) |
| Check if the component's assigned command exists.
|
|
| cmd_args_str (self) |
| Return list of arguments, making sure they are all converted to strings.
|
|
| setup (self) |
| Perform any necessary setup for this component to run such as making symlinks to required directories.
|
|
| cleanup (self) |
| Perform post-job cleanup such as deleting temporary files.
|
|
| config_logging (self, parser) |
| Configure the logging for a component.
|
|
| set_parameters (self, params) |
| Set class attributes for the component based on JSON parameters.
|
|
| optional_parameters (self) |
| Return a list of optional parameters.
|
|
| check_config (self) |
| Raise an exception on the first missing config setting for this component.
|
|
| input_files (self) |
| Get a list of input files for this component.
|
|
| output_files (self) |
| Return a list of output files created by this component.
|
|
| config_from_environ (self) |
| Configure component from environment variables which are just upper case versions of the required config names set in the shell environment.
|
|
|
| _inputs_to_outputs (self) |
| This is the default method for automatically transforming input file names to outputs when output file names are not explicitly provided.
|
|
Merge LCIO files.
Definition at line 1530 of file tools.py.
◆ __init__()
__init__ |
( |
|
self, |
|
|
** |
kwargs |
|
) |
| |
◆ cmd_args()
Setup command arguments.
- Returns
- list of arguments
Reimplemented from LCIOTool.
Definition at line 1540 of file tools.py.
◆ nevents
The documentation for this class was generated from the following file: